One cup of Dark chocolate is around 236.2 grams and contains approximately 1339.5 calories, 19.8 grams of protein, 96.9 grams of fat, and 82.7 grams of carbohydrates.
Dark chocolate is a rich, delectable treat made from cocoa solids, cocoa butter, and sugar, featuring a higher cocoa content than its milk chocolate counterpart. Originating from the cacao trees of Central America, it boasts a deep, intense flavor that tantalizes the taste buds. Packed with antioxidants, dark chocolate may improve heart health and boost brain function, making it a smart indulgence.
